Discuss the social factors of alcohol affecting mental health
Alcohol consumption can have significant social factors that impact mental health. These factors include societal norms, peer pressure, social isolation, and the influence of advertising and media.
Alcohol is often associated with social gatherings and celebrations, making it a commonly accepted and expected part of many social interactions. This can create a social pressure to drink and conform to the norms of alcohol consumption, which may lead to excessive or problematic drinking.
Peer pressure can also play a significant role, as individuals may feel compelled to drink in order to fit in or avoid social exclusion. However, excessive alcohol use can have negative effects on mental health, such as increased risk of depression, anxiety, and substance use disorders.
Moreover, alcohol can contribute to social isolation and loneliness. While alcohol may initially provide a temporary sense of relaxation or escape, excessive or prolonged use can lead to withdrawal from social activities and relationships, ultimately worsening feelings of isolation and depression.
Additionally, the influence of advertising and media can shape perceptions and behaviors related to alcohol consumption. Glamorized portrayals of drinking in media can normalize excessive drinking and contribute to the perception that alcohol is necessary for socializing or coping with stress, which can further exacerbate mental health issues.
In conclusion, the social factors surrounding alcohol, including societal norms, peer pressure, social isolation, and media influence, can significantly impact mental health. Understanding and addressing these factors is crucial for promoting a healthier relationship with alcohol and supporting individuals in maintaining positive mental well-being.

neuman itis has a breathing rate of 10 breaths/min. clinical testing determined that his physiological dead space was 350 ml. his tidal volume is 600 ml. What is his minute ventilation (use correct units)? What is his alveolar ventilation (use correct units)?
The given breathing rate of Neuman itis is 10 breaths/min. The tidal volume is 600 ml and the physiological dead space is 350 ml.
Find the minute ventilation and alveolar ventilation: The amount of air a person takes in in one minute is called minute ventilation.
it figure out by multiplying the tidal volume by the number of breaths per minute.
Tidal volume x Breathing rate = minute ventilation Change the numbers:
Tidal volume = 600 ml Rate of breath = 10 breaths per minute Minute ventilation
= 600 ml x 10 breaths/min = 6000 ml/min
Neuman itis has a minute ventilation of 6000 ml/min because of this.
The amount of air that gets to the alveoli and takes part in gas exchange is called alveolar ventilation.
Take the tidal volume and subtract the physiological dead space. Then, multiply the result by the breathing rate. Alveolar ventilation = (Tidal volume - physiologic dead space) Breathing rate Change the numbers: Tidal volume = 600 ml Dead space in the body is 350 ml
Rate of breath = 10 breaths per minute Alveolar ventilation = (600 ml - 350 ml) × 10 breaths/min = 2500 ml/min
So, Neuman itis has an alveolar ventilation of 2500 ml/min.

total number of households watching the program divided by the total number of households that have access to watching the tv program.
The total number of households watching the program divided by the total number of households that have access to watching the TV program gives the percentage of households watching the TV program.
This percentage is known as the rating of the TV program. The rating of a TV program is an important factor for advertisers to decide whether they should advertise during the time slot of the program or not.
TV rating is a term used by television broadcasters and advertisers to measure the popularity of TV programs. It provides an estimate of the size of the audience that is watching a particular program. It is important for broadcasters to know the rating of their program because it determines the revenue they can generate from advertising. Advertisers are willing to pay more to advertise during popular programs, as it ensures that their ads will reach a larger audience. The formula for calculating TV rating is:
Rating = Total number of households watching the program / Total number of households that have access to watching the TV program
The result of this calculation is then multiplied by 100 to get the percentage of households watching the program. For example, if the rating of a program is 10, it means that 10% of all households that have access to watching the program are currently watching it.

What are the three primary sources of health insurance?
Answer:
Private insurance (either through an employer or purchased on their own), Medicare and Medicaid.
Explanation:
The three primary sources of health insurance are -
Private insuranceMedicareMedicaidHealth insuranceHealth insurance is the insurance coverage of medical and surgical expenses incurred by the insured individual. There are different types of health insurance on their sources.
Private insurance is insurance that is purchased by employers or on their own. Medicare is the insurance program for elder people above 60 or 65 by the federal government. Medicaid is the insurance program initiated by the state and federal governments to give some health insurance to people with low income and resources.

Roscoe has insisted on an eco-friendly burial when he dies. this would most likely take the form of omitting the c. embalming process.
Roscoe's eco-friendly burial would most likely omit the embalming process. Embalming involves the use of chemicals to preserve the body and make it presentable for an open casket funeral. However, these chemicals can be harmful to the environment and can seep into the ground and water supply. By omitting the embalming process, Roscoe's burial would be more environmentally sustainable and reduce his impact on the planet after death.
An eco-friendly burial focuses on reducing the environmental impact of traditional burial methods. Embalming involves using chemicals to preserve the body, which can potentially harm the environment. By omitting the embalming process, Roscoe's eco-friendly burial will be more environmentally friendly and allow for a more natural decomposition.

why might hospitals be exempt from the e prescribing core objective
Hospitals may be exempt from the e-prescribing core objective due to technical limitations, unique workflows, or specific regulatory considerations surrounding controlled substances.
One possible reason is if the hospital does not have a certified electronic health record (EHR) system in place that supports e-prescribing functionality. Another reason could be if the hospital's patient population falls outside the scope of e-prescribing, such as if the majority of patients are not prescribed medications.
Additionally, certain hospitals, such as long-term care facilities or psychiatric hospitals, may have specific exemptions based on their unique patient care settings and requirements. These exemptions are typically granted to ensure that the objectives align with the specific needs and capabilities of the hospital.
